CHAPEL (Site of) [Achscoraclate] | Marwood Sutherland William Gunn Achscoriclett A Sinclair Achscoriclett |
027 | This name applies to the remains consisting of a heap of stones of a Catholic Chapel, Situated at the corner of a field, at Achscoriclett The font for the holy water is still to be seen among the other stones at this place. Human remains have also been interred here, but not within this last 60 years. Beyond this I can learn nothing about it. |
